Bubble Pop Adventures Game Review

Bubble Pop Adventures Game Background

Bubble Pop Adventures is a cute bubble shooter game where your goal is to knock off all of the bubbles with mushrooms trapped in them.

You have a limited amount of ammo to free all the mushrooms. As you advance through the game many unique bubble types are added to the playing field.

MarketJS published this game.

How to Play Bubble Pop Adventures

Press the pink and cream colored play button in the bottom center of the welcome screen to bring up the level select screen.

Move your mouse to aim and press the left click button to throw a bubble at the stack. Add bubbles to sets to create 3 or more adjacent identical bubbles to knock them off of the stack.

A tree stump in the lower left contains the next up bubble. You can tap on the tree stump to swap the current bubble and the next bubble.

Basic Gameplay Advice

Aiming

You can aim your shots directly at the stack, or use the dotted aiming tool to ricochet your shots off the walls.

If the bubble you are aiming does not have an easy spot to play it consider switching it with the next up bubble. If both bubbles do not have a good play spot consider placing it out of the way in a position that does not block your other shots and can easy fall away by making sets above it.

Levels

This game features 23 levels and an endless mode. The endless mode is unlocked after beating all 23 stages. Levels are not timed, but you are given a limited number of bubbles to clear the stage.

The goal of each stage is to knock all of the mushrooms trapped in bubbles off of the stack before you run out of bubbles.

Each stage has a unique design layout and a bubble limit. You score points for each bubble knocked off the stack, with larger bonuses for big clear outs. At the end of each stage you also earn 10 points for each bubble you have remaining in ammo. Your level score then determines your star rating on that stage.

Special Bubbles

As you advance through the game some special bubble types are added.

  • Minus bubbles: hitting sets that include these cause you to lose 3 of your remaining bubbles from your ammo. Knocking them off indirectly by knocking off different colored bubbles that connect them to the stack does not cause you to lose ammo.
  • Wood: you can not knock them off directly, but have to knock off the surrounding bubbles connecting them to the stack to get them to fall as well.
  • Clear bubbles: they turn the color of an adjacent bubble which was popped while sitting next to them.
  • Plus bubbles: hitting sets that include these cause you to gain 3 remaining bubbles in your ammo. Knocking them off indirectly by knocking off different colored bubbles that connect them to the stack does not cause you to gain ammo.
  • Thunder bubbles: hitting one of these with any bubble causes the entire row the thunder bubble is on to be destroyed, and any bubble below that line to fall off the stack.
  • Skull bubbles: if you hit any of them you automatically lose the level.
  • Star bubbles: when you hit a star bubble it automatically destroys all other bubbles of the same color you used to hit the star bubble.

Advanced Playing Tips & Strategy

Most stages are quite easy, particularly if you take advantage of the special bubble types. If you see a thunder bubble try to work the area around it to remove it rather than working the other side of the stack.

The final stage is exceptionally hard. There are many skull bubbles, and when you shoot near them it is easy for the bubbles to accidentally bump into them, so it is best to aim away from them whenever possible, and when you must hit near them try to hit the far side of adjacent bubbles.

Player Age Recommendations

This game is fun for all ages. Almost anybody can beat the first half of the stages. Experienced bubble shooter game players should be able to complete the game without losing more than once or twice on the first 22 stages, then playing the final stage a half-dozen times or so until they beat it.
